What do these Stats Mean?
The 47LH90 features “TruMotion”, which refreshes the image at 240 frames per second (240 hz), which eliminates motion blur and image judder; two major problems previously associated with LED TVs.
The local dimming feature ensures that the dark parts of the picture are dark, while light parts of the picture stay light.
